High-shear granulation of hygroscopic probiotic-encapsulated skim milk powder: effects of moisture-activation and resistant maltodextrin
A fine, hygroscopic, and poorly flowable probiotic powder encapsulating Lactobacillus rhamnosus GG (LGG) was granulated using a high-shear granulation process, wherein a small amount of water (4%, w/w) was used for moisture-activation with or without 10% (w/w) resistant maltodextrin (RM).
